Species Description and Distribution |
Habitat in Europe: |
Damp, usually shady places |

Botanical Description: |
Biennial to perennial, occasionally annual, 10-50 cm; stem flexuous, hairy, especially at the base. Lowest leaves pinnate, with 2-7(8) pairs of ovate to reniform lateral leaflets and a somewhat larger terminal leaflet; cauline leaves 4-10, larger than the basal, with 2-6(7) pairs of ovate-lanceolate leaflets; leaflets dentate to entire. Pedicels 2-3 mm at anthesis. Petals 2.5-4(-5) mm, about twice as long as the sepals; stamens 6 (sometimes fewer). Siliqua (8-)12-25 x 1-1.5 mm, erecto-patent, scarcely overtopping the flowers; style 1-1.5 mm, conical. Seeds 1-1.4 x 0.8-0.9 mm. |
Chromosome number: |
2n=32 |
Distributional range: |
Europe, from about 25° E. westwards. |
